Sodium Fluoride Toothpaste
Generic Name: sodium fluoride toothpaste
Brand Names:
Truguard 5000
DESCRIPTION : Self-topical neutral fluoride dentifrice containing 1.1%(w/w) sodium fluoride for use as a dental caries preventive in adults and pediatric patients.

Uses
INDICATIONS AND USAGE : A dental caries preventive; for once daily self-applied topical use. It is well established that 1.1% sodium fluoride is safe and extraordinarily effective as a caries preventive when applied frequently with mouthpiece applicators. 1-4 TruGuard brand of 1.1% sodium fluoride in a squeeze tube is easily applied onto a toothbrush. This prescription dental cream should be used once daily in place of your regular toothpaste unless otherwise instructed by your dental professional. May be used whether or not drinking water is fluoridated, since topical fluoride cannot produce fluorosis. (See WARNINGS for exception.)
Dosage
DOSAGE AND ADMINISTRATION: Follow these instructions unless otherwise instructed by your dental professional: 1. Adults and pediatric patients 6 years of age or older, apply a thin ribbon of TruGuard to a toothbrush. Brush thoroughly once daily for two minutes, preferably at bedtime. 2. After use, adults expectorate. For best results, do not eat, drink or rinse for 30 minutes. Pediatric patients, age 6-16, expectorate after use and rinse mouth thoroughly. Directions: Use As Directed This prescription dentifrice is recommended for adults and pediatric patients 6 years and older. • Apply a thin ribbon of TruGuard 5000 along the length of the toothbrush no more than "pea size” total dose. Brush for two minutes.
Side Effects
ADVERSE REACTIONS: Allergic reaction and other idiosyncrasies have been rarely reported.
Warnings
WARNINGS: Prolonged daily ingestion may result in various degrees of dental fluorosis in pediatric patients under 6 years, especially if the water fluoridation exceeds 0.6 ppm, since younger pediatric patients frequently cannot perform the brushing process without significant swallowing. Use in pediatric patients under age 6 years requires special supervision to prevent repeated swallowing of the cream which could cause dental fluorosis. Read directions carefully before using. Keep out of reach of infants and children. CONTRA INDICATIONS: Do not use in pediatric patients under age 6 years unless recommended by a dentist or physician.
Pregnancy
Pregnancy : Pregnancy Category B. It has shown that fluoride crosses the placenta of rats, but only 0.01% of the amount administered is incorporated in fetal tissue. Animal studies (rats, mice, rabbits) have shown that fluoride is not a teratogen. Maternal exposure to 12.2 mg fluoride/kg of body weight (rats) or 13.1 mg/kg of body weight (rabbits) did not affect the litter size of fetal weight and did not increase the frequency of skeletal or visceral malformations.
